The sudden arrival of new orders forced Rasa to halt his original plans.

Judging by the urgency of the ssenger, this was clearly a priority mission.

Given the current state of the Hidden Mist, any "priority mission" would almost certainly revolve around the Hidden Sand. Their entire command structure was currently obsessed with one thing: crushing the Sand Village as quickly as possible.

"I thought I'd lost my chance to gather Mist intelligence, but it seems the intel has co knocking on my door."

Rasa controlled his avatar, Gengetsu Hozuki, and fell in line with the squad.

The captain, preoccupied with the new directives, no longer had the energy to bully him.

Gradually, other units rged with theirs until the group swelled to over forty ninja.

Ahead, a large sand dune rose from the desert floor.

A figure stepped out from behind it.

Rasa's pupils constricted slightly.

"Fuguki Suikazan."

"Looks like the Mist is making a major move. For Fuguki himself to lead the team... that man is as insidious as they co."

The Sand and Mist had been at war for years. Both villages had accumulated mountains of intelligence on one another.

Just as the Mist hated Pakura to the bone, the Sand had their own list of most-hated Mist ninja.

Fuguki Suikazan was right at the top.

He was cunning, treacherous, and possessed a dark intelligence that had cost the Sand dearly in blood. Among the Seven Ninja Swordsn, Fuguki was easily the one the Sand wanted dead the most.

Rasa's gaze shifted to the massive, bandaged weapon slung across Fuguki's back—Sahada, the Shark Skin.

"That sword... is excellent."

Setting aside its combat capabilities, Sahada possessed a unique property that made it incredibly effective against Tailed Beasts.

And the Sand had a serious Tailed Beast problem.

Currently, the One-Tails, Shukaku, was still sealed within the priest Bunpuku. Gaara hadn't been born yet. Relations between Shukaku and the village were hostile at best, with the beast having rampaged several tis already.

"If I could get my hands on Sahada, Shukaku would no longer pose a threat to the village."

"I could even use Sahada to turn Shukaku into a high-capacity, sustainable chakra generator. The utility would be endless. Even if I just used that chakra to transport water, the value to the Sand would be imasurable."

"With water, the oases would expand. The desert would recede."

"The soil would beco fertile, and our resources would multiply."

Fuguki Suikazan looked over the gathered crowd, his expression grave.

"Listen up. Today's operation is critical. It will determine the pace at which we crush the Hidden Sand."

"Juzo, Jinin, and I have been preparing for this for a long ti."

Rasa's internal expression turned serious.

He had initially assud this was just a standard special ops mission.

But with four of the Seven Ninja Swordsn mobilized simultaneously? This was no ordinary raid. Who in the entire Sand Village warranted this level of force?

The answer was obvious.

Rasa's eyes flickered.

"It's either a surprise attack on the village itself, or they are targeting the one commander in the Sand army the Mist fears most."

"But we're too far from the village for a raid to be practical. That leaves only one option: This is an assassination operation targeting Pakura."

Fuguki continued speaking.

"For this mission, I need ten n for a suicide squad. Who is willing to step forward?"

"Regardless of who you are, the village will not forget your sacrifice. You will be heroes of the Mist. Your nas will be recorded in the village archives forever."

"The Mizukage himself will preside over your funeral."

"And your families will receive a massive pension from the village."

A suicide squad. A mission with zero chance of survival.

re patriotic rhetoric wasn't enough; they needed financial incentives. Even for Mist ninja, who weren't exactly known for fearing death, the price had to be right.

Rasa, controlling Gengetsu, raised his hand high in the air.

Fuguki glanced in Rasa's direction, his eyebrows raising slightly.

"A mber of the Hozuki clan?"

But his surprise was fleeting.

Fuguki didn't stop "Gengetsu Hozuki" from volunteering to die.

He looked at the ten n who had raised their hands.

"You ten, you're in."

"Wait for my signal and follow the plan. Our target is the Sand's Pakura. She has slaughtered too many of our kin. It is very likely that your friends, partners, or family mbers have died at her hands."

"I expect you to give everything you have."

"Killing Pakura will be a massive victory for the Mist."

"When the Mist wins, we all benefit."

"You will be the greatest heroes of the war!"

The ten suicide soldiers looked determined, resolution burning in their eyes.

"Rest assured, Lord Fuguki. We will complete the mission!"

"The Mist will prevail!"

"Pakura must die!"

Rasa blended into the suicide squad, making sure to look unremarkable.

The group moved out, heading toward a known water source nearby.

Before long, a figure appeared in the distance, moving to intercept them.

It was a Sand ninja.

Fuguki didn't seem surprised by the appearance of the enemy. In fact, it seed he had co here specifically to et him. The two didn't fight; they stood close and began to talk.

Rasa narrowed his eyes.

"A traitor..."

"No wonder Fuguki seed so confident."

"He found a rat inside the Sand. Soone willing to sell Pakura out."

"You can defend against a thousand enemies, but it's hard to defend against one of your own."

Rasa stared hard at the Sand ninja, burning the traitor's face into his mory.

Soon, the conversation ended.

Fuguki turned back to the suicide squad.

"Hide here and wait for my command!"

"The signal is sand. The mont I throw sand into the air, you charge."

The ten n exchanged glances and nodded in unison.

"Yes, Lord Fuguki!"

Ti ticked by, agonizingly slow.

The scorching sun beat down rcilessly. The sand absorbed the heat until it was hot enough to cook at. There wasn't a breath of wind. Sweat poured off the n, dripping onto the baking earth.

Psychologically, Rasa could handle it.

But this body—Gengetsu Hozuki's body—wasn't adapting well to the extre environnt.

The other nine soldiers were in the sa boat.

At this point, they were almost wishing for death just to escape the heat.

Finally.

A handful of yellow sand was flung into the air by Fuguki.

"Charge!"

Rasa reacted instantly.

While the other suicide troops were still bracing themselves, Rasa controlled Gengetsu to sprint out from cover first.

The mont he broke cover, he scread at the top of his lungs, his voice echoing across the dunes with fanatical intensity.

"BWAHAHAHAHA!"

"Pakura of the Sand! Today is the day you die!"

"Lord Fuguki, Lord Juzo, and Lord Jinin have set an inescapable trap for you right here! I, Gengetsu Hozuki, have co to take your head!"

"KILL HER!!!"

Hidden behind the sand dune, Fuguki Suikazan froze when he heard Gengetsu's screaming.

His face went from surprised to pitch black in a split second.

"Is this Gengetsu kid fucking retarded?"
